npub represents a novel concept in teh realm of decentralized digital identities, especially within blockchain-based networks. Serving as a standardized public key format, npub functions as a human-readable identifier that enhances usability without compromising security. Unlike customary cryptographic keys, which are often lengthy and complex, npub keys are encoded in a way that simplifies sharing and verification across platforms.
The design of npub addresses critical challenges faced by users in managing cryptographic credentials by offering:
- Readability: Encoded strings that are shorter and easier to transcribe.
- Compatibility: Seamless integration with various decentralized applications.
- Security: Retaining cryptographic integrity through underlying encoding mechanisms.
To better understand its structure,consider the following simplified breakdown of an npub key format:
| component | Description |
|---|---|
| prefix | Indicates the key type (e.g., “npub”) |
| Payload | Encoded public key data |
| Checksum | Ensures data integrity |
By adopting npub keys, developers and users can experience a streamlined approach to identity and key management, paving the way for increased adoption of secure, user-friendly cryptographic solutions.
Create your Nostr Profile

